spoolsv.exe进程占用率100%

来源:百度知道 编辑:UC知道 时间:2024/04/26 22:45:32
spoolsv.exe进程占用率100%,在C:\WINDOWS\system32\spool\PRINTERS 目录下会生成00002.SPL样的多个文件 ,结束spoolsv.exe,把PRINTERS里的内容清空,一会又会出来,而且spoolsv.exe进程占用率100%,很烦人,网上查了是病毒,但又没找到杀毒的办法,请各位大侠帮忙~~~~~~!!!!!!!!!!!!!!!
打印机个数为0

这个东西有可能是一个笑话,呵呵

你看看你的电脑里有没有一个MS的虚拟打印机,如果有,再看看里面有没有任务,如果有,就删掉它,一切顺利的话,问题就解决了

1.在开始工具栏点运行再输入services.msc或者双击C:\WINDOWS\system32\services.msc打开服务管理器,找到Print Spooler这个服务并停止。
2.找到“C:\WINDOWS\system32\spool\PRINTERS”这个资料夹,看它下面是否有文件存在,如果有全部删除。再重新启动Print Spooler 这个服务。问题应该可以解决。
3.如果还不行,下载最新的杀毒软件进安全模式全盘杀毒。

经查,没有$systemroot$/system32/spoolsv这个目录,判定不是病毒;
经摸索发现解决办法是:先运行net stop spooler命令,停下SPOOLSV.EXE进程,然后到WINDOWS\system32\spool\PRINTERS(Windows XP操作系统)或WINNT\system32\spool\PRINTERS(Windows 2000操作系统)目录下,把里边的文件全部删除,再运行net start spooler命令,重新启动SPOOLSV.EXE进程。这样,不打印作业时,SPOOLSV.EXE进程的CPU占用率为0,系统完全恢复正常。
原因是:$systemroot$/system32/spool/PRINTERS里面保留了几个打印任务,这些打印任务产生了死循环。
如果还不行,删除多余的打印机。

要不杀毒软件杀,要不重装系统